Licensing and Regulatory Status – Is Rainbet Legit?
When you type “is rainbet legit” into a search engine, the first thing you’ll see is a reference to the Curacao eGaming licence. That licence is a common one for many online casinos and sportsbooks, and it means the operator has met a set of basic standards for fairness and security. For Australian punters, however, the Curacao licence does not give the same level of consumer protection as an Australian‑issued licence would.
That said, the licence does require Rainbet to use a Random Number Generator (RNG) that is independently tested. Independent testing bodies such as iTech Labs or eCOGRA periodically audit the games to ensure the outcomes are truly random. In practice, this means the odds you see on the site are not being tampered with – a key factor in judging legitimacy.
Security Measures and Player Protection
Rainbet uses 128‑bit SSL encryption on all pages where personal data or financial information is entered. This is the same level of encryption you’d find on major banks, so your login details and card numbers are scrambled before they ever leave your browser. In addition, the platform employs two‑factor authentication (2FA) for withdrawals, which adds a second step beyond just a password.
Beyond tech, Rainbet has a self‑exclusion tool and links to responsible‑gambling organisations like Gambling Help Online. If you ever feel you’re chasing losses, you can lock yourself out for a set period or set deposit limits directly in your account settings.

Bonuses and Promotions – What to Expect
Rainbet’s welcome package is advertised as a “match bonus up to $1,000 plus 100 free spins”. In reality, the match bonus is 100% on your first deposit up to $500, and the remaining $500 comes from a second‑deposit boost. The free spins are credited on selected slot titles and carry a 30x wagering requirement.
Beyond the welcome offer, Rainbet runs regular reload bonuses, “Bet of the Day” sports promotions, and a loyalty scheme that awards points you can exchange for cash or bonus credits. For Australian players who enjoy both casino games and sports betting, the combined promotions can be a decent value, provided you read the fine print on wagering requirements.
Payment Methods and Withdrawal Speed
Depositing money at Rainbet is a breeze thanks to a range of local Australian options. You can use credit/debit cards (Visa, MasterCard), POLi, and popular e‑wallets such as Skrill and Neteller. Most deposits are processed instantly, allowing you to start playing within seconds of clicking “Confirm”.
Withdrawals, however, take a bit longer. The site processes payout requests within 24 hours, but the actual arrival time depends on the method you choose. Below is a quick snapshot of typical processing times:
| Payment Method | Processing Time | Fees |
|---|---|---|
| Credit / Debit Card | 1‑3 business days | None (may apply bank fees) |
| POLi | Same day | No fee |
| Skrill / Neteller | Instant to 24 hours | Up to $10 |
| Bank Transfer (local) | 2‑4 business days | No fee |
Keep in mind that Rainbet will request a copy of your ID before the first withdrawal – a standard KYC (Know Your Customer) step. Once you’re verified, subsequent withdrawals usually sail through faster.
